Hey — quick handover on FixtureForge, our test-data factory lib. It's pretty stable; most of the magic lives in `builders/` and the trait mixins. Watch out for the sequence reset bug in parallel runs (there's a note in the README). New folks should pair on their first factory. For anything gnarly, ping the maintainer listed below.

named custodian: Brivan Eliath Quenox Frador

The garage occupancy feed for the Brindlewood campus arrives over a message queue every thirty seconds, one record per level, published by the Stallgrid edge boxes. Counts can briefly go negative when a sensor double-fires on exit; the ingest job clamps these to zero and flags the interval. If the feed stalls for more than five minutes, the dashboard falls back to the last known snapshot. Sensor mappings, queue names, and the replay procedure are documented on the internal page below.

runbook for tahog-kadug: https://gitlab.qirvanworks.corp/projects/pages/view/b139298aed28

Action item from the Quillbeam outage review: the feed resolver issued one query per node, producing the N+1 pattern that saturated the Orchardine replica during peak. The fix batches lookups through a dataloader layer with per-request caching, merged behind the feed_batching flag. Before enabling in the release train, verify batch sizes against replica headroom and confirm the timeout budget still fits the gateway SLA. Rollback is the flag flip only. The dataloader tuning constants, for release sign-off, are as follows.

tuning constants:
QUOTAS = {
    "druwyn": 5,
    "holix": 5,
    "zorath": 5,
    "holwyn": 10,
}